Yes, voltage fluctuations can potentially damage fridge components. Refrigerators are sensitive electrical appliances that rely on a stable and consistent power supply to function properly. Voltage fluctuations, both high and low, can have adverse effects on their internal components. Here's how they can cause damage:

  1. High Voltage Surges: A sudden increase in voltage, often referred to as a voltage surge, can lead to excessive current flowing through the refrigerator's electrical circuits. This surge can overload and damage sensitive components like the compressor, control board, or motor.

  2. Low Voltage (Brownouts): Low voltage situations, also known as brownouts, occur when the voltage supplied to the refrigerator drops below the normal operating range. During brownouts, the refrigerator may not receive enough power to run its components at the necessary capacity, leading to stress on the motor and compressor. This prolonged stress can cause premature wear and tear, leading to component failure.

  3. Inconsistent Voltage: Fluctuations in voltage can cause fluctuations in power supply, leading to erratic operation of the fridge's components. For instance, the compressor may start and stop frequently, affecting its efficiency and longevity.

  4. Electronic Control Damage: Refrigerators often have electronic control boards that manage various functions and settings. Voltage fluctuations can disrupt these control boards and result in malfunctions or complete failure of the refrigerator's control system.

To protect your fridge from potential damage due to voltage fluctuations, consider taking the following precautions:

  1. Use a Voltage Stabilizer: Installing a voltage stabilizer can help regulate the incoming voltage and protect the refrigerator from sudden surges and dips.

  2. Unplug During Severe Fluctuations: In case of severe electrical storms or power outages, it's advisable to unplug the fridge temporarily to avoid damage from extreme voltage variations.

  3. Regular Maintenance: Periodic maintenance and servicing of the refrigerator can help identify and rectify any underlying issues that may have arisen due to voltage fluctuations.

  4. Check Electrical Wiring: Ensure that the electrical wiring in your home is up to code and capable of handling the load of your appliances. Faulty or inadequate wiring can exacerbate the impact of voltage fluctuations.

By taking these precautions, you can significantly reduce the risk of voltage-related damage to your refrigerator and extend its lifespan.
